Introduction to Algorithms
MIT's foundational course on designing and analyzing efficient algorithms, taught as part of MIT's Electrical Engineering and Computer Science curriculum and cross-listed with the Singapore-MIT Alliance as SMA 5503. Lectures cover sorting, search trees, heaps, and hashing, divide-and-conquer methods, dynamic programming, amortized analysis, graph algorithms, shortest paths, and network flow, plus computational geometry, number-theoretic algorithms, polynomial and matrix calculations, caching, and parallel computing. Materials on MIT OpenCourseWare include full video lectures, problem sets, and exams with solutions, letting learners work through the same assignments given to MIT students. No enrollment or certificate is offered, but the complete set of course materials is free to use. The course builds from basic complexity analysis toward advanced graph and optimization techniques used throughout computer science and engineering practice.
